Panel W/B
Composite/Component signal Equipment NTSC (or PAL according to the system) signal generator Color meter
1) Set the AV mode and input the white pattern signal from NTSC (or PAL according to the system) signal generator. 2) Press the Menu button twice to access main menu and set the manual W/B to Cool. 3) Access the Panel W/B mode and align the Low Light and High Light shown below by using color meter.

Change the Manual W/B to Normal by the Menu button and STR button. Modify the Data as follows. Increase R Drive 24 steps and reduce B drive 2 steps and B cutoff 1 step from Cool mode. 7) Change the Manual W/B to Warm by the Menu button and STR button. 8) Modify the Data as follows. Increase R Drive 30 steps and reduce B drive 35 steps, and B cutoff 2 steps from Cool mode. 9) Access the SG Hold mode (Forced signal system set mode) and set the system to NTSC (or PAL). 10) Return to the Panel W/B mode and copy the Data 3 for each item. 11) Repeat item 9) and 10) for SECAM system.
